I _REALLY_ recommend snort. Get it from www.snort.org. There are quite a few useful extensions available and you can get fresh rulesets all the time so you don't have to bother keeping up woth everything yourself ;o)) Run it with a stealth setup: External interface brought up with no IP address assigned - only ssh on the internal net. Practically invisible. I think it performs best with a BSD-style OS (Free/Open). Bye, Jan -- Radio HUNDERT,6 Medien GmbH Berlin - EDV - j.muenther () radio hundert6 de
